The Rambutan London menu is inspired by Chef Cynthia Shanmugalingam’s heritage, and it highlights the rich culinary traditions of northern Sri Lanka, blending influences from both Tamil and Sri Lankan cultures.
Restaurant Info & Owner
Rambutan is located at 10 Stoney Street, London SE1 9AD, right near Borough Market. It is not just a restaurant but a celebration of Sri Lankan cuisine in the heart of London. The name “Rambutan” itself is derived from a tropical fruit native to Southeast Asia, symbolizing the exotic flavors and experiences the restaurant offers.
The restaurant was founded by Chef Cynthia Shanmugalingam, a culinary expert with deep roots in Sri Lanka and Tamil cuisine. Chef Cynthia has worked extensively to bring the flavors of her homeland to the UK, focusing on creating an accessible yet authentic menu that features fresh ingredients, vibrant spices, and traditional cooking techniques.
Rambutan is known for its open kitchen concept, where diners can enjoy the sights, sounds, and smells of dishes being prepared over a live flame. The Full Rambutan London Menu
The Rambutan London menu is diverse and offers a mix of small plates, main dishes, rice, sides, and desserts. The menu is designed to allow guests to share different dishes, making it ideal for groups and family-style dining. From snacks to hearty curries and grilled meats, each dish is carefully prepared with the freshest ingredients and the boldest flavors.
Small Plates & Short Eats

| Dish Name | Description |
|---|---|
| Gundu Dosas | A crispy version of traditional Sri Lankan rice balls served with a spicy green chutney. |
| Devilled Cashews & Plantain Chips | A flavorful, crispy snack, perfect for sharing while you sip on a drink. |
| Aubergine Moju | Fried aubergine slices served with a tangy and spiced vinegar dressing. |
| Fish Cutlets | Sri Lankan-style fish cakes made with fresh seafood and a blend of spices. |
Main Dishes (Curries & Mains)

| Dish Name | Description |
|---|---|
| Red Northern Prawn Curry | A delicious curry made with prawns, tamarind, and coconut milk, creating a rich and flavorful dish. |
| Black Pork Curry | A coconut milk-based curry featuring tender pieces of pork cooked with Sri Lankan spices. |
| Kalupol Grilled Chicken | Grilled chicken marinated in black coconut and a mix of traditional Sri Lankan spices, served with sides. |
| Sri Lankan Fish Curry | A spicy and tangy fish curry made with fresh fish, turmeric, and tamarind, offering a true taste of Sri Lanka. |
Rice, Rotis & Sides

| Dish Name | Description |
|---|---|
| Samba Rice | Traditional Sri Lankan rice served as the perfect base for curries. |
| Butter Roti | Soft and buttery flatbread, ideal for scooping up rich curries and dips. |
| Coconut Sambol | A fiery condiment made with coconut, chili, and other spices, often served with rice or curries. |
| Parippu (Dhal Curry) | Lentil curry, cooked to perfection with coconut milk and spices. |
Vegetarian & Vegan Dishes

| Dish Name | Description |
|---|---|
| Pumpkin Curry | A hearty curry made with fresh pumpkin, coconut milk, and a blend of Sri Lankan spices. |
| Mushroom & Cashew Stir Fry | A stir-fried combination of mushrooms and cashews, served with a blend of Sri Lankan spices. |
| Vegetable Rotis | A combination of mixed vegetables wrapped in a soft roti, perfect for dipping into curries. |
Desserts

| Dish Name | Description |
|---|---|
| Coconut Panna Cotta | A rich, creamy dessert made with coconut milk and a subtle hint of vanilla. |
| Palm Sugar Cake | A moist, sweet cake made with palm sugar, a traditional Sri Lankan delicacy. |
